Witryna7 paź 2024 · Key Points. Question What is the prevalence of mental illness and mental health care use among police officers at a large, urban police department?. Findings In this survey study of 434 police officers, 12% had a lifetime mental health diagnosis and 26% reported current symptoms of mental illness. WitrynaThe authority to use force by law enforcement officials derives from the duty of the State to maintain public order, and to ensure human rights and the rule of law. The use of force can therefore be necessary, such as for the protection of life, health and public safety. International human rights law is the international legal framework ...
